Why Local SEO Is More Relevant Than Ever
Local SEO has become a mission-critical advantage for businesses in Fort Smith, Arkansas, where a strong manufacturing backbone, deep historical roots, and a steadily growing population shape how residents search for services. In a city that serves as a key economic hub for the Arkansas–Oklahoma border region, visibility in local search results is no longer optional — it is essential for staying competitive. Whether serving families in Chaffee Crossing, long-time residents on the east side, or professionals working along Rogers Avenue, companies that invest in localized optimization are far better positioned to attract high-intent customers who expect dependable service, clear communication, and the kind of straightforward, relationship-driven business culture that Arkansas is known for.
This urgency is amplified by the industry-wide transition from traditional keyword-focused SEO to entity-based optimization. Search engines like Google are no longer simply matching phrases — they are working to understand the “who,” “what,” and “where” behind each business, mapping contextual relationships and credibility indicators that reflect real-world trust. This shift matters deeply in Fort Smith, where consumer expectations often differ from those in neighboring states: local residents value authenticity, consistency, and long-term customer commitment. For companies anchored in this region — especially those serving both Arkansas and Oklahoma customers — maintaining accurate listings, authoritative citations, and a cohesive digital identity has become indispensable. As Google grows smarter, prioritizing meaning and context over isolated keywords, businesses that embrace entity SEO gain a long-term competitive edge.
